User Tag List

Страница 20 из 21 ПерваяПервая ... 161718192021 ПоследняяПоследняя
Показано с 191 по 200 из 207

Тема: ПК8000 - Эмуляция и все что с ней связано

  1. #191

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,392
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от DemonId7 Посмотреть сообщение
    Менять их можно только во время прихода прерывания!
    Это если для практически полезных целей. А для извращений можно попробовать и при рисовании активной области. Например можно попробовать изобразить мультиколорный screen 1, когда каждая строка будет своим цветом. Примерно так:
    1. Заполняем весь экран одним кодом символа (или двумя).
    2. Под мультиколор выделяем только часть ширины экрана, примерно половину.
    3. В оставшейся части строки: включаем гашение (эта часть экрана, как я понимаю, будет черной), меняем один-два (больше не успеем) цвета, выключаем гашение (лучше в невидимой области).
    В статичном виде это не особо интересно, но можно сделать скролл цветов вверх или вниз, или не просто скролл а более хитрое изменение (переливания, "взрывы" и т.п.).
    Последний раз редактировалось ivagor; 27.08.2019 в 15:35.

  2. #192

    Регистрация
    18.02.2010
    Адрес
    г. Пенза
    Сообщений
    407
    Спасибо Благодарностей отдано 
    18
    Спасибо Благодарностей получено 
    68
    Поблагодарили
    31 сообщений
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    .
    3. В оставшейся части строки: включаем гашение (эта часть экрана, как я понимаю, будет черной)
    Не, не будет. Вроде обсуждали уже, что "гашение" на суре неправильное и не приводит к реальному гашению экрана.
    Можем проверить, мой комп - твой код

  3. #193

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,392
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Попробовал изобразить нечто отдаленно похожее на свое описание.
    bload"BLNK1",r
    пробел - выход в бейсик
    курсором вправо и влево можно подвигать область гашения/программирования

    UPD: BLNK2
    1. Исправил ошибку - зависание при долгой работе
    2. Добавил отображение позиции сдвига в виде шестнадцатеричного числа (печатается два раза - вверху и внизу)
    3. Когда добавил п.2 стало видно, что сдвиг слишком быстрый - замедлил
    Вложения Вложения
    • Тип файла: zip BLNK2.zip (4.7 Кб, Просмотров: 81)
    Последний раз редактировалось ivagor; 27.08.2019 в 19:02. Причина: заменил на исправленную и дополненную версию

  4. #194

    Регистрация
    21.08.2006
    Адрес
    Ижевск
    Сообщений
    941
    Спасибо Благодарностей отдано 
    23
    Спасибо Благодарностей получено 
    298
    Поблагодарили
    164 сообщений
    Mentioned
    20 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    UPD: BLNK2
    https://yadi.sk/d/xvYZnNvpHNWAJQ


    Последний раз редактировалось DDp; 27.08.2019 в 20:42.
    фдеукю у-ьфшдЖ ввз"шярюсщь D356 47C0 35F8 F55E 8A52 A88F F3F8 B003 03EB 3D7F

    Этот пользователь поблагодарил DDp за это полезное сообщение:

    ivagor(27.08.2019)

  5. #195

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,392
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    DDp, спасибо! Видео очень информативное, очень поможет, если Pyk соберется реализовть эту фичу.
    Т.е. цвет гашения - белый? А черное - запись в РУ2.
    Для совсем полного счастья сделал третий вариант. Он скорее не заменят второй, а дополняет. Там два символа на экране и меняются два цвета в строке. Т.е. вероятно на реале должно быть: цветной-out86-белый-outA0-узкий черный-белый-outA1-узкий черный-белый-out86-цветной. Перебираются все 256 возможных комбинаций цветов. За пределами этих 128 строк все черное, кроме белых цифр.
    Вложения Вложения
    • Тип файла: zip BLNK3.zip (4.8 Кб, Просмотров: 67)

  6. #196

    Регистрация
    21.08.2006
    Адрес
    Ижевск
    Сообщений
    941
    Спасибо Благодарностей отдано 
    23
    Спасибо Благодарностей получено 
    298
    Поблагодарили
    164 сообщений
    Mentioned
    20 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    Для совсем полного счастья сделал третий вариант.
    Я немного изменил... BLNK4 по той же ссылке.
    У меня слабо отличаются ЯРКИЙ/НЕЯРКИЙ (кстати, штатная коробочка "ТВ адаптер").

    Получается:
    цветной-out86-белый-outA0-узкий PAPER-белый-outA1-узкий PAPER-белый-out86-цветной.
    Т.е. цвет гашения - белый. А PAPER - запись в РУ2.
    (Paper - цвет сброшенных/нулевых пикселей)



    С накрученной контрастностью:
    Последний раз редактировалось DDp; 27.08.2019 в 23:07.
    фдеукю у-ьфшдЖ ввз"шярюсщь D356 47C0 35F8 F55E 8A52 A88F F3F8 B003 03EB 3D7F

    Этот пользователь поблагодарил DDp за это полезное сообщение:

    ivagor(28.08.2019)

  7. #196
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  8. #197

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,392
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    DDp, спасибо!
    Из-за подозрения про "черный" участок и paper как раз сделал 3 с изменением цвета фона.
    Но я все же забыл сделать проверку - а как на бордюре? Вспомнил только когда уже комп выключил.

    Еще вопрос - что за вертикальная белая полоса у левых нулей (в upcontrast2 она почти не видна)?

  9. #198

    Регистрация
    07.08.2008
    Адрес
    г. Уфа
    Сообщений
    8,392
    Спасибо Благодарностей отдано 
    763
    Спасибо Благодарностей получено 
    2,367
    Поблагодарили
    1,317 сообщений
    Mentioned
    39 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Доработал BLNK2 до BLNK22
    1. Теперь можно перемещать область гашения не только по горизонтали, но и по вертикали (курсор вверх и вниз). Внизу слева - позиция по горизонтали, справа - по вертикали
    2. Пробегаются все комбинации цветов от 0 до 255
    Вложения Вложения
    Последний раз редактировалось ivagor; 28.08.2019 в 19:33. Причина: успел быстро заменить на v2

  10. #199

    Регистрация
    21.08.2006
    Адрес
    Ижевск
    Сообщений
    941
    Спасибо Благодарностей отдано 
    23
    Спасибо Благодарностей получено 
    298
    Поблагодарили
    164 сообщений
    Mentioned
    20 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    Доработал BLNK2 до BLNK22
    BLNK22_avi.7z

    - - - Добавлено - - -

    Цитата Сообщение от ivagor Посмотреть сообщение
    что за вертикальная белая полоса у левых нулей (в upcontrast2 она почти не видна)?
    Так, смещение между пикселями и атрибутами.
    А если где-то менее заметно - это я крутил регуляторы у тв-тюнера и установил "резкость" максимально в минус.
    фдеукю у-ьфшдЖ ввз"шярюсщь D356 47C0 35F8 F55E 8A52 A88F F3F8 B003 03EB 3D7F

    Этот пользователь поблагодарил DDp за это полезное сообщение:

    ivagor(28.08.2019)

  11. #200

    Регистрация
    05.04.2013
    Адрес
    Починки, Нижегородская обл.
    Сообщений
    1,371
    Спасибо Благодарностей отдано 
    403
    Спасибо Благодарностей получено 
    647
    Поблагодарили
    255 сообщений
    Mentioned
    26 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от ivagor Посмотреть сообщение
    Видео очень информативное, очень поможет, если Pyk соберется реализовть эту фичу.
    Попробую сделать, когда немного освобожусь, но 100% точность обещать не буду - экран ПК8000 у меня реализован далеко не так пунктуально, как экран Вектора...

Страница 20 из 21 ПерваяПервая ... 161718192021 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. ДВК (и всё, что с ними связано)
    от Grand в разделе ДВК, УКНЦ
    Ответов: 4575
    Последнее: 17.11.2025, 11:38
  2. ПК8000 - Общие вопросы
    от Mick в разделе ПК8000
    Ответов: 601
    Последнее: 03.11.2025, 00:03
  3. PAL/GAL и все что с ними связано.
    от Mick в разделе Клоны на ПЛИС, МК и БМК
    Ответов: 489
    Последнее: 19.09.2025, 18:39
  4. Ответов: 226
    Последнее: 28.04.2025, 09:42
  5. Ответов: 71
    Последнее: 25.02.2010, 22:40

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•